Abstract

The highway beyond visual range alarm system comprises a video alarm linkage platform, a two-dimensional code alarm board, an early warning prompting device, an induction warning lamp and an expansion interface device which are matched with each other; the video alarm linkage platform is internally provided with a GIS position assembly, the GIS position assembly is used for receiving position information of the two-dimensional code alarm board, the early warning prompting device and the induction warning lamp so as to form early warning alarm to automatically judge equipment distribution at a certain distance in front of an alarm point position, and automatically trigger the early warning prompting device and the induction warning lamp to send accident early warning and warning in advance within a certain distance of the arrival direction of the alarm point position after receiving an alarm signal; the video alarm linkage platform is correspondingly connected with the two-dimensional code alarm board, the early warning prompting device and the induction warning lamp through the 4G communicator respectively.

Background art:
at present, the total mileage of roads in China exceeds 519.81 kilometers, the total mileage of roads of second and above main lines exceeds 67.2 kilometers, wherein the mileage of an expressway exceeds 16 kilometers, the expressway has obvious advantages that the speed is high, the traffic capacity is high, the transportation cost is saved, the driving safety and the like are not possessed by common roads, and more people can prefer the expressway when adopting motor vehicles to go out. High-speed traffic accidents caused by factors such as wide territory, extreme climate change, severe weather and the like occur in China. In addition, fatigue driving and vehicle failure are also important factors causing highway traffic accidents and secondary accidents. The secondary accidents of the highway always troubles highway traffic management departments in various regions due to the characteristics of high occurrence probability, high prevention and control difficulty, serious consequence hazard, higher rescue difficulty and the like. Relevant statistics indicate that the occurrence of a secondary traffic accident within 5 minutes from the formation is about 60%, and the occurrence within 5 to 10 minutes is about 20%. The meaning of "time is life" is especially profound in the prevention of secondary accidents. If the alarm receiving time can be shortened as much as possible, scientific and effective early warning measures are taken in time, and the occurrence probability of secondary accidents is greatly reduced.
When an accident or vehicle fault occurs at one point, if the rear motor vehicle cannot timely know abnormal conditions such as a traffic accident in front and the like when driving on the expressway, secondary accidents are easily caused when the motor vehicle decelerates to drive; furthermore, due to the reasons that the road conditions of the parties are not familiar, the people who are in danger are nervous after an accident, and the like, the alarm people often cannot quickly and effectively determine the positions of the alarm people, and people without rescue knowledge may not accurately describe the conditions of the accident scene. Therefore, how to alarm quickly and accurately and how to know the field situation intuitively and accurately by the alarm center, the alarm policeman can reach the accident point more quickly and accurately, and the pain point and the short board for preventing secondary accidents are formed.
In the process of running on a highway, when a vehicle needs to call for help after an accident occurs, the vehicle can often give an alarm only by calling, and because a driver is not familiar with road conditions or cannot observe an accurate prompting device, the position information reported by the accident is inaccurate, so that the vehicle is not beneficial to a policeman to accurately and quickly arrive at the scene, and the timely arrival of rescue force is easily delayed;
the existing accident prevention early warning only prompts through a simple indicator, has a single early warning form, is poor in practicability, has large defects and defects in functionality, and cannot be well applied to different weather conditions or application scenes; meanwhile, due to the lack of network assistance in the existing early warning system, effective linkage is lacked among a plurality of functional components, so that accident early warning or warning cannot be sent out in advance, and effective help is provided for a driver.

To video alarm linkage platform, except having GIS map position show function, can also install APP of different categories and come the auxiliary operation, several kinds of APP commonly used include installation operation and maintenance basic APP: when the equipment is installed and maintained, the method is used for reporting the position information of the equipment and the environment around the equipment, mainly whether dangerous factors such as a pond, a cliff and the like exist nearby the equipment; policeman APP: the alarm linkage platform is used for receiving alarm information pushed or issued by the alarm linkage platform and other alarm related instructions, and can navigate to an accident occurrence point by one key according to position information in the alarm; and the rescue end APP can receive the accident point position condition and the accident site condition pushed by the video alarm linkage platform and can navigate to the accident occurrence point by one key according to the specific information of the accident point position.
Preferably, the two-dimensional code warning boards are made of orange reflective materials and have obvious night identification, each warning board is provided with a unique two-dimensional code and is bound with the video warning linkage platform, and when a user has an accident or needs to seek help on a highway, the user can report the accident or the help seeking condition to the video warning linkage platform by scanning the two-dimensional codes and can carry out video call with a platform attended police.
Specifically, the early warning and warning device mainly comprises a sound player, an LED screen and a sound-light alarm, can automatically receive early warning or reminding signals sent by the video alarm linkage platform according to the warning point location information, and sends out corresponding early warning or reminding signals.
Preferably, the audible and visual alarm comprises a first electromagnetic relay and a second electromagnetic relay which are connected in parallel, the first electromagnetic relay is connected with a bicolor flashing lamp, and the second electromagnetic relay is connected with a buzzer so as to send out a strong audible and visual early warning signal.
Preferably, the model of the sound player is WT588D, 20 pins are arranged on the sound player, and the pin ten of the sound player is grounded through a first capacitor; the eleventh pin of the sound player is connected with a power supply through an indicator light and a first resistor; be connected with the speaker on sound player's sixteen numbers pins, it has second resistance and the setting of second electric capacity ground connection to connect in parallel on the speaker, and the cooperation LED screen provides more manifold information suggestion for the driver.
Particularly, the video alarm linkage platform is correspondingly connected with the two-dimensional code alarm board, the early warning prompting device and the induction warning lamp through the 4G communicator respectively, and when different external devices are connected through the expansion interface device, unified setting and connection can be carried out through the 4G communicator.
Preferably, the model of the 4G communicator is SIM800C, 42 pins are arranged on the 4G communicator, the first pin, the second pin and the third pin of the 4G communicator are communication pins, and an antenna is arranged on the thirty-two pin of the 4G communicator; a fifteen-pin, a sixteen-pin, a seventeen-pin and an eighteen-pin of the 4G communicator are connected with a SIM card through a first resistor, a second resistor and a third resistor; a first capacitor, a second capacitor, a third capacitor and a fourth capacitor are respectively arranged on a pin fifteen, a pin sixteen, a pin seventeen and a pin eighteen of the 4G communicator, and a stable wireless network can be established to carry out communication and control on different functional components.
Particularly, the Lora communicator is arranged on the intelligent induction lamp to connect the main control assembly with the sub-control assembly to trigger and drive the intelligent induction lamp to act, so that instructions and data can be conveniently transmitted.
